It’s easy to assume that the 5G mobile network is essentially just a faster version of 4G, and it is. But it’s also so much more.
For one: 5G actually has the potential to be up to 100 times faster than 4G. And with speeds like that, 5G is poised to support some incredible healthtech leaps — connecting healthcare professionals and patients, in real-time, in ways that simply weren’t possible before.
Imagine a consultant in Australia making detailed diagnoses via video link for patients in Spain, or London, or the middle of the Congo — all in crystal-clear 4K video. This instant two-way interaction becomes a real possibility with the speed of 5G.
If you’ve seen practically any sci-fi movie from the last 100 years, you’ll recognize the concept of a high-tech device that can diagnose a patient with the wave of a hand.
In 2020, this has become more science than fiction.
Selected as a CES 2020 Innovation Awards Honoree in two categories, the MedWand is a “telemedicine” device designed to enable remote consultations with patients (making it the perfect partner for 5G connectivity). Each MedWand unit allows a patient to self-examine, instantly sending data back to the clinician from multiple sensors including a stethoscope, pulse monitor, throat illuminator, thermometer, respiratory rate, and much more.
Along with all of this incredible tech, the MedWand is also roughly the size of a computer mouse and weighs less than 5 ounces. That small size equals portability, meaning this healthtech can get to remote regions where it can make a big difference.

While life-changing healthtech innovation is absolutely critical, we can’t forget about the small innovations, too.
And they don’t come much smaller than babies.
While there have been plenty of smart devices aimed at parents, there’s never been anything quite like Lumi By Pampers. Essentially a fully-fledged smart diaper, this piece of tech is made up of three different parts: a camera, a mobile app, and — most importantly — a smart sensor that attaches to the baby’s diaper.
Once Lumi is all set up, frazzled parents will be able to use the mobile app to monitor exactly how long the baby has slept, how long ago they had their last bottle, and the last time they were changed.
But that’s not all.
Perhaps the most useful part of Lumi is that it will send you a push notification if the baby is wet and needs a change — say goodbye to diaper rash, for good!
